Rent price trends

Rent prices for all bedroom counts and property types in Bedford, OH have increased by 2% in the last month and have increased by 6% in the last year.

We analyze our inventory and calculate this information on a 30-day rolling basis.

Rent price summary for
Bedford, OH

As of August 2025, the median rent for all bedroom counts and property types in Bedford, OH is $1,110. This is -44% lower than the national average.

Rent comparables in
Bedford, OH

The monthly rent for an apartment in Bedford, OH is $1,050. A 1-bedroom apartment in Bedford, OH costs about $815 on average, while a 2-bedroom apartment is $1,120. Houses for rent in Bedford, OH are more expensive, with an average monthly cost of $1,595.
